Green Power Renewable Energy Market to Hit $219.47 Billion by 2035
The global Green Power Market is on a remarkable growth trajectory, with projections showing an increase from USD 54.49 Billion in 2024 to USD 219.47 Billion by 2035, reflecting a compound annual growth rate of 13.5%. According to Market Research Future, this expansion is driven by technological advancements and increasing consumer demand for sustainable energy. Green power renewable energy encompasses electricity generated from environmentally friendly sources such as solar, wind, hydro, and bioenergy, offering a clean alternative to fossil fuels. The market analysis, with 2024 as the base year, provides comprehensive insights into this transformative sector.
The report segments the market by type (Hydroelectric Power, Wind Power, Bioenergy, Solar Energy, Geothermal Energy), by application (Electricity Generation, Heating, Transportation), and by end user (Utility, Residential, Commercial, Industrial). Solar Energy currently dominates the market due to declining costs and widespread adoption across residential and commercial installations. Wind Power is the fastest-growing segment, with heightened investments and advancements in turbine technology. Electricity Generation holds the largest application share, supported by established infrastructure and renewable sources. Utilities lead the end-user segment, driven by large-scale renewable projects and regulatory incentives.
North America is the largest market, with the U.S. holding approximately 60% of the market share, driven by robust investments and supportive government policies. The Asia-Pacific region is the fastest-growing, fueled by increasing energy demands and government initiatives promoting renewable energy. Key players include NextEra Energy, Enel, Orsted, Siemens Gamesa, Vestas Wind Systems, and Iberdrola.
Industry Trends
A primary trend is the rapid scaling of utility-scale solar farms and offshore wind projects. The acceleration of these projects is causing a significant redistribution of green power market share among major energy providers. The declining cost of solar and wind technology is making these sources increasingly competitive with fossil fuels. The focus on large-scale projects is a key driver of market growth.
Another key trend is the development of green hydrogen and advanced energy storage systems to address intermittency challenges. As renewable energy penetration increases, the need for reliable storage and flexible solutions is growing. Green hydrogen, produced from renewable electricity, offers a pathway to decarbonize hard-to-abate sectors. The focus on energy storage and hydrogen is a key area of innovation.
The rise of corporate sustainability initiatives is also a significant trend. Many corporations are committing to 100% renewable energy targets, driving significant investments in green power. Over 70% of large companies are actively seeking to procure renewable energy, creating a substantial demand for green power. This corporate demand is accelerating the transition to renewable energy.
Challenges
Despite the growth, the green power renewable energy market faces challenges. The intermittency of solar and wind power requires effective energy storage solutions, which can add to system costs. The need for grid modernization to accommodate variable renewables is a significant challenge. Transmission infrastructure must be upgraded to connect renewable-rich areas to load centers.
The availability of land for large-scale renewable projects can also be a constraint. Competing land uses and environmental concerns can make siting projects difficult. The supply chain for critical materials, such as rare earth metals for wind turbines and lithium for batteries, can also be vulnerable to disruptions.
